Out of the Abyss.
A Facsimile of the Original Manuscript of
“The Empty House” by Sir Arthur Conan Doyle
with Annotations and Commentary on the Story.
Edited & introduced by
Andrew Solberg, BSI, Steven Rothman, BSI, and Robert Katz, MD, BSI.
“The Adventure of the Empty House” holds a special place in the hearts of Sherlockians as the tale that resurrected Sherlock Holmes after his encounter with Professor Moriarty at the Reichenbach Falls. Out of the Abyss, published by The Baker Street Irregulars in cooperation with The Rosenbach Collection of the Free Library of Philadelphia, includes a reproduction of the original manuscript of the story, along with an annotated typescript and commentary, supplemented by a history of the manuscript’s ownership.
This larger-format volume also contains trenchant analysis by a number of noted scholars. Among the topics addressed are the compassion of Inspector Lestrade, Mycroft as facilitator and confidante, Watson’s true role during the Great Hiatus, and the psyche of Colonel Sebastian Moran.
248 pages, 10″ x 7″ hardcover, December 2014
With the manuscript reproduction plus 19 b&w illustrations

About the Series
The Baker Street Irregulars, the literary society focused on Sherlock Holmes, in cooperation with leading libraries and private collectors, publishes The Manuscript Series to bring to the public facsimile editions of manuscripts and other documents relating to Sherlock Holmes and Sir Arthur Conan Doyle, with insightful commentary by talented Sherlockian and Doylean writers.
